Unplugged Music Festival in Reykjavík Café

Interest group Undercover Music Lovers are organizing an unplugged music festival in the recently-opened Café Rósenberg in Reykjavík this weekend. Eighteen acts from five different countries will perform during the festival.

“It is very important to have an interest group focusing on strengthening the community of musicians, not just business relations but also friendship and cooperation in the music scene,” organizer Svavar Knútur told Fréttabladid.

Performing bands and artists include Toben Stock from Germany, Owls of the Swamp from Australia, Kid Decker from Britain, Svavar Knútur himself, Helgi Valur and Bergthór Smári from Iceland.

Admission to all concerts is free which will be 4 pm – 11 pm on both Saturday and Sunday.
